Production Coordinator

Halon - Production · Contract Position · Intermediate

About The Position

We are looking for an enthusiastic, motivated professional to join our team as a Production Coordinator. In this role, you will support the project supervisor and team, maintain production schedules, and handle a variety of other tasks that ensure projects run smoothly. If you are well-organized, skilled multi-tasker who thrives in a fast-paced environment, then you may be an excellent candidate for this position. This is a remote-work opportunity.


Duties and Responsibilities

  • Perform general clerical duties to support directors, producers, and production managers
  • Manage project calendars and maintain production schedules
  • Collaborate with Supervisors, Producers, and Project Managers to meet the needs of the team
  • Participate in short- and long-term planning aligned with goals set by managers
  • Work with all departments that contribute to the production
  • Other duties as assigned

Requirements

  • Internships at studios or production companies are an asset
  • Previous experience as a production coordinator or production assistant
  • Familiarity with all aspects of production to facilitate effective communication
  • Superb organizational skills and time management
  • Ability to complete multiple tasks in a fast-moving environment 
  • Capable of meeting deadlines and working with daily time constraints
  • Excellent written and spoken verbal communications; professional telephone etiquette
  • Knowledge of Shotgrid, Maya, or Unreal Engine is a huge bonus
  • Ability to deliver superior service and build lasting relationships by demonstrating NEP’s Core Values: innovative, one team, passion and integrity.


Salary Range:

  • $30 - $40 per hour
